The excitement around Monad stems largely from its technical foundation. The project has positioned itself as a highly efficient, parallel-execution blockchain designed to offer ultra-high throughput without sacrificing Ethereum compatibility. Investors have long sought alternatives that can deliver scalability, developer flexibility, and low transaction costs and Monad’s architecture promises all three. As a result, the mainnet launch was more than a technical milestone; it was seen as a catalyst for real ecosystem expansion, bringing developers, liquidity providers, and early DeFi projects into a rapidly emerging network.
